About tert-butyl (3S)-3-(methylcarbamoyl)-3,4-dihydro-1H-isoquinoline-2-carboxylate
tert-butyl (3S)-3-(methylcarbamoyl)-3,4-dihydro-1H-isoquinoline-2-carboxylate (PubChem CID 18394404) has the molecular formula C16H22N2O3
and a molecular weight of 290.36 g/mol. Its IUPAC name is tert-butyl (3S)-3-(methylcarbamoyl)-3,4-dihydro-1H-isoquinoline-2-carboxylate.

What is the SMILES notation for tert-butyl (3S)-3-(methylcarbamoyl)-3,4-dihydro-1H-isoquinoline-2-carboxylate?
The canonical SMILES for tert-butyl (3S)-3-(methylcarbamoyl)-3,4-dihydro-1H-isoquinoline-2-carboxylate is CNC(=O)[C@@H]1Cc2ccccc2CN1C(=O)OC(C)(C)C.
What is the InChIKey of tert-butyl (3S)-3-(methylcarbamoyl)-3,4-dihydro-1H-isoquinoline-2-carboxylate?
The InChIKey is KFXWVLNEAZALCR-ZDUSSCGKSA-N. The full InChI is InChI=1S/C16H22N2O3/c1-16(2,3)21-15(20)18-10-12-8-6-5-7-11(12)9-13(18)14(19)17-4/h5-8,13H,9-10H2,1-4H3,(H,17,19)/t13-/m0/s1.
What are the key properties of tert-butyl (3S)-3-(methylcarbamoyl)-3,4-dihydro-1H-isoquinoline-2-carboxylate?
tert-butyl (3S)-3-(methylcarbamoyl)-3,4-dihydro-1H-isoquinoline-2-carboxylate has a molecular weight of 290.36 g/mol, XLogP of 2.09, 1 rotatable bonds, 1 hydrogen bond donors, and 3 hydrogen bond acceptors.
